    /**
     * Set of the subscription IDs that identifies the network or request, empty if none.
     */
    @NonNull
    private ArraySet<Integer> mSubIds = new ArraySet<>();

    /**
     * Sets the subscription ID set that associated to this network or request.
     *
     * @hide
     */
    @NonNull
    public NetworkCapabilities setSubIds(@NonNull Set<Integer> subIds) {
        mSubIds = new ArraySet(Objects.requireNonNull(subIds));
        return this;
    }

    /**
     * Gets the subscription ID set that associated to this network or request.
     * @return
     */
    @NonNull
    public Set<Integer> getSubIds() {
        return new ArraySet<>(mSubIds);
    }

    /**
     * Tests if the subscription ID set of this network is the same as that of the passed one.
     */
    private boolean equalsSubIds(@NonNull NetworkCapabilities nc) {
        return Objects.equals(mSubIds, nc.mSubIds);
    }

    /**
     * Check if the subscription ID set requirements of this object are matched by the passed one.
     * If specified in the request, the passed one need to have at least one subId and at least
     * one of them needs to be in the request set.
     */
    private boolean satisfiedBySubIds(@NonNull NetworkCapabilities nc) {
        if (mSubIds.isEmpty()) return true;
        if (nc.mSubIds.isEmpty()) return false;
        for (final Integer subId : nc.mSubIds) {
            if (mSubIds.contains(subId)) return true;
        }
        return false;
    }

    /**
     * Combine subscription ID set of the capabilities.
     *
     * <p>This is only legal if the subscription Ids are equal.
     *
     * <p>If both subscription IDs are not equal, they belong to different subscription
     * (or no subscription). In this case, it would not make sense to add them together.
     */
    private void combineSubIds(@NonNull NetworkCapabilities nc) {
        if (!Objects.equals(mSubIds, nc.mSubIds)) {
            throw new IllegalStateException("Can't combine two subscription ID sets");
        }
    }
